| Mochrum Fishing Club consists of 40 members
who fish Mochrum Loch which is near Maybole, Ayrshire. The loch covers
an area of 24 acres and is stocked with both Brown, Blue and Rainbow trout.
Access to the loch is from the B7203 Pennyglen/Maybole road turning
south at the farm road to Mochrum Farm. Mochrum Loch is open to a
limited number of non-members to a maximum of 5 day tickets and 2
evening tickets. The loch is open 7 days a week with the exception of
competition days which are the first Sundays in each month. The season
is the normal trout season from 15th March to the 6th October.
Tickets are priced at £15 per Day from 10am till 11pm with a limit of 4 fish. Evening tickets are £10 from 6pm till 11pm with a limit of 2 fish. Children aged 15 and under may fish on the adult ticket Free of Charge but the combined fish limit will remain as the ticket states for both anglers. There is boat facilities for disabled anglers. Disabled angler must make a booking in advance, so that someone will be in attendance, they should also be accompanied by a helper. The boat is fitted to take wheelchairs and is powered by an electric outboard motor and at the moment there is no charge for the use of the boat This water is strictly FLY ONLY with no spinning or bait fishing.Permits to fish the loch can be obtained from:- The STATION STORE Culzean Road, at Maybole Railway station Telephone No 01655889413
Report:- Well everything is going great guns, fish are all feeding well on the great hatches of buzzers mostly black with some green amongst them, fish are in great condition with catches daily with an average weight of around three pounds and fighting fit. It has been slow over the last couple of weeks owing to the bright sunshine during the day but some good catches in the evening with good rises of fish. Kingsley Whitefield won the Kelco Cup, and Bert Stewart and his fishing partner won the Fairbairn Trophy in the Pair Competition.
